The Gerudo Summit is located at the peak of the the [[Gerudo Highlands]]. It is a very cold, snowy climate, with the temperatures being bitterly cold. Link will need to wear armor with [[Cold Resistance]], such as the [[Snowquill Set]] in order to survive. The summit has very steep cliffs on all sides, making it rather difficult to climb up. At the center of the summit, there is a dangerous [[White-Maned Lynel]] that is patrolling the area. The Lynel carries a [[Savage Lynel Spear]] and a [[Savage Lynel Bow]]. | |||
There are four [[Korok]]s that can be found on and around the summit. Three of them are all next to each other at the west end of the summit. One requires Link to pickup a series of yellow flowers. It begins was down at the [[Risoka Snowfield]], just south of the overhang. This requires quite the amount of Stamina and Link will likely need some stamina elixirs to get all the flowers. A second Korok is located at the west end, near the overhang. There is a block puzzle on the higher ledge to the east, with the missing block being all the way to the west, guarded by a pair of [[Black Bokoblin]].
